Wan Hai Lines Launches JKH Service
By Aiswarya Lakshmi
April 10, 2018
Taiwanese shipping company Wan Hai Lines has announced the launch of Japan – Korea – Haiphong service “JKH service” on April 22, 2018. This new service will help to extend Wan Hai Lines network by providing direct service from Japan, Korea to Haiphong.
This service will be jointly operated by WHL and IAL using three vessels with nominal capacity of 1,800 TEU. Wan Hai Lines will deploy two vessels, while IAL will operate one vessel.
JKH’s maiden voyage will commence from Pusont Apri 22l, 2018 and arrive in Haiphong on May 1, 2018. It will be a 21-day fixed round trip schedule.
The port rotation is: Hakata – Moji – Pusan – Ulsan – Kwangyang – Keelung – Kaohsiung – Haiphong – Shekou – Hong Kong – Xiamen – Hakata.
